Scott Rendell is out of contract at Woking after spending two stints there this season. He scored 17 goals in 36 appearances, which is a pretty decent return for a striker playing in a mid table conference side. I know Hargreaves took a look at him in January and decided not to offer him anything but we are in the conference now so would he be worth another look? He is a proven goalscorer in the conference and could form a good partnership with Benyon as he has done so in the past for us.
